How Reliable is the Rover Mini?
Based on 519,169 MOT tests across 45,631 vehicles.

R536 CGO is a 1997 Rover Mini in Multi-colour with a 1,275cc petrol engine. This vehicle has been through 26 MOT tests with a personal pass rate of 57.7%.
Across all 1997 Rover Mini models, the average MOT pass rate is 66.4% with a typical mileage of 51,557 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Rover Mini fails its MOT is subframe mounting prescribed area is excessively corroded, accounting for 32,036 recorded failures. If you're considering buying R536 CGO, it's worth having these areas checked by a mechanic before committing.
The Rover Mini typically stays on UK roads for around 47 years. At 29 years old, this Rover Mini is well into its expected lifespan but still has years ahead.
